Pressing the START key causes the centrifuge run to begin. This key can also be used to
abort a deceleration process and restart the centrifuge.
The STOP key can be pressed to end a run. It operates in two modes, depending on how
you press it:
• Normal stop (press and release):
The centrifuge decelerates to a complete stop according to the preselected
deceleration rate. Deceleration can be terminated and the centrifuge restarted by
pressing START again. The centrifuge emits a series of audible tones when the rotor

• Fast stop (press and hold for at least two seconds):
The centrifuge decelerates to a complete stop at the maximum rate. The
deceleration cannot be interrupted; the centrifuge can only be restarted after the
rotor stops and the door is opened and closed.
Pressing the OPEN DOOR key unlatches the centrifuge door locks and allows the door
to be opened. The centrifuge accepts this command only when the rotor is completely
stopped and the OPEN DOOR key LED is lit.
Pressing the PULSE key causes the installed rotor to accelerate at the maximum rate up
to the set speed for short-duration runs (as long as the key is pressed). Deceleration, at
the maximum rate, begins when the key is released.

The cursor keys are up and down arrow keys, which can be pressed to increment values
up or down when setting parameters.
Parameter (speed, time, temperature, and acceleration or deceleration profile)
changes made while a run is in progress must be verified by pressing the ENTER key.
When the RPM key is pressed the last digit in the RPM/RCF/ROTOR display (0) flashes,
indicating that the speed can be entered in increments of 100 revolutions per minute
(RPM). After the run starts, the actual RPM of the rotor is displayed.
The RCF key can be used to select the speed setting by required relative centrifugal
field (RCF). The corresponding RPM is automatically calculated and displayed during
the run. If the RCF key is pressed during the run, the RCF value is shown in the
RPM/RCF/ROTOR display.
Pressing the Rotor key displays the rotor number.
